I think the sound design on this show was fantastic. From the dreamy echo on the disembodied voices in the elevator/drink me sequences to the pronouncement of every wacky synth-effect in "Welcome to Wonderland" to the clarity of the vocals to the point of catching every lyric without trouble. The balance between the vocals and orchestra was spot on for every different genre of music in the show and the sound effects were strong. I know it's easy to overlook good sound design (like good orchestrations) in a hit or miss score, but this is something Wonderland actually got right.
